Abstract

The aim of this article is to present the stages of development of the Trinitarian charism in Poland and to discuss the ways of its implementation, as well as to answer the question to what extent the Polish Trinitarians in their more than three hundred years of history have adapted the religious charism to their native conditions in changing historical circumstances. This, in turn, will allow better understanding of the heritage and activities of the Trinitarian Order in Poland, as well as to bring closer its multifaceted impact on various areas of Church and social life. The issues raised here, as a type of case study, can also contribute to a better understanding of the development, actualization and adaptation of the religious charism in general, or at least illustrate this process with a concrete example.
